UCMAS (Universal Concept of Mental Arithmetic System) is a globally recognized brain development program for children aged 5–13 years. It uses the ancient abacus method to strengthen core cognitive skills while making learning fun, fast, and confidence-boosting. Kids start with a physical abacus and gradually move to mental visualization, helping them perform calculations quickly in their head — like a superpower. Our hands are our second brain.
